Install Java Runtime Environment (JRE)
Daffodil requires Java 8. If you do not already have the Java Runtime Environment, it can be downloaded for free at https://java.com/en/download/.
Obtain The Latest Daffodil Release
Visit the Daffodil Artifacts Page to download the latest Daffodil stable or development releases.
Run Daffodil
After you have downloaded the latest Daffodil Release, you'll want to uncompress the files into a suitable location on your machine. The uncompressed directory contains a bin
directory that contains two scripts: daffodil.bat
for Windows, and daffodil
for Linux. These files must be executed on the command line. See the Examples page to see how to execute and use the Daffodi CLI, and the Command Line Interface page for the in depth usage.
